Ingredients

8 chicken thighs
8 pork steaks
4 tablespoons olive oil or 4 tablespoons Crisco
1 -2 onion , diced
6 garlic cloves , crushed
2 bay leaves
1 dried red pepper
1 cup water
1/4 cup nakano rice vinegar
1/2 cup Kikkoman soy sauce
1 can coconut milk
Islands Chicken & Pork Filipino Adobo is a popular dish in the Philippines, where it is often served during special occasions and family gatherings. The dish is believed to have originated in the Tagalog region and has since become a staple in Filipino cuisine. This version of the dish uses coconut milk, which adds a unique sweetness to the savory flavor of the dish, making it even more delicious and satisfying.

Instructions

1.Heat olive oil or Crisco in a large pot over medium-high heat.
2.Add onions and garlic, sauté until browned.
3.Add chicken and pork, and cook until browned on both sides.
4.Add bay leaves, dried red pepper, water, rice vinegar, and soy sauce.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low and simmer for 40 minutes.
5.Add the coconut milk, and continue simmering for another 10 minutes until the sauce thickens.
6.Discard bay leaves and red pepper. Serve hot with rice and vegetables.

CONS

This dish contains a high amount of sodium, which may not be suitable for people with high blood pressure or heart disease.

The recipe also calls for a lot of meat which may not be suitable for vegetarians or those watching their cholesterol intake.
